Iconic "Friends" Sofa Goes Under the Hammer

The comedy series "Friends" started broadcasting on September 22, 1994, and ahead of the 30-year anniversary, several items and clothes worn by the series' stars will be sold at auction, reports People.

The auction itself will take place on Monday, September 23, at the auction house Julien's in Los Angeles, but can also be followed online. Among the treasures is the iconic orange sofa from the Central Perk café, which is expected to bring in between 20,000 and 30,000 Swedish kronor.

Among around 100 memorabilia are also clothes worn by Courteney Cox, Jennifer Aniston, Lisa Kudrow, Matt LeBlanc, Matthew Perry, and David Schwimmer, as well as guest stars and various interior design details from the main characters' homes.

Every day, "Friends" is broadcast on a channel somewhere around the world, which describes the series' enormous popularity and its attraction for new fans decades later. We are proud to present this iconic collection that came to us from Warner Bros, says David Goodman, CEO of Julien's Auctions.
